Abstract:Impacts on growth of young trees of Pinus Koraiensis of 6 environmental factors of intensityof sunlight, direct sunlight, thickness of soil humus, neighboring trees, upper canopy species, herbs andshrubs were investigated on young tree of Pinus Koraiensis and 4 neighboring trees which are consideredthe structural unit of the microenvironment. Results indicated that the 6 environmental factors underinvestigation had effects, to various extents, on growth of the young trees. Based on the findings, suitablegrowing conditions for regenerated young tree of Pinus Koraiensis under forest were identified andcorresponding silvicultural measures were proposed for operational practice.
